Motorsports fans all over the world hold NASCAR racing in the highest respect in regard to other racing leagues or associations. The term "NASCAR" is actually an acronym for "National Association For Stock Car Auto Racing", and was originally founded by a man named Bill France. The sport of stock car racing has grown considerably since its humble beginnings, and boasts an ever growing and loyal fan base that supports and perpetuates its existence. Due to this boom in its popularity, racing events are now held in huge arenas that seat thousands upon thousands of eager fans. Even though these arenas have the capacity to hold such large crowds, NASCAR racing events often sell out as a result of the high demand for NASCAR tickets.
